Test Inspection Engineer


Details:
Description:

We are currently recruiting for a Test Inspection Engineer for our client in the Aberdeen area. This will be a permanent position and will entail a mixture of yard, site and offshore work. If not looking to do offshore work candidates will still be considered,
The client is an expert provider of wire rope products, including marine mooring equipment and anchoring systems. The company offers heavy spooling services, proof testing and inspection facilities, and full rigging shop services.
The main purpose of the role will be responsibility for performing quality control, inspections, testing, and evaluations of products and processes to ensure compliance with established standards and customer requirements.
The main duties will include but not be limited to:-
Carrying out any inspections and testing work of manual handling and lifting equipment in accordance with LOLER and PUWER regulations.
Service and repair lifting equipment on customer’s sites and in the company workshop as required.
Ensuring all relevant paperwork is completed accurately and correctly to ensure customer compliance and safety.
Adhering to Quality, Environmental and Health & Safety regulations.
Maintaining the company vehicle, completing the relevant daily checks.
Helping to keep all shared areas and workshop clean and tidy.
Skills/Experience
Previous experience of carrying out LOLER and PUWER inspections on a variety of lifting equipment, including (but not limited to); Chains, Slings, Shackles, Manual/Powered Hoists, Lifting Beams + many more.
LEEA Qualifications or time served in relevant industry.
Customer focused with strong communication and relationship building skills.
Proactive with a positive attitude, well organised and punctual.
Attention to detail and ability to identify and solve problems
Ability to use own initiative and work in a fast-paced environment.
Ability to work alone, or as part of a team in a workshop environment or on customer sites.
Good communication skills and ability to work in a team environment
IT Literate.
Must have a full UK Driving Licence.
Ongoing training will be given and this will include offshore certification/courses if required. Van available for site work. additional day rate payment for offshore work.
Core week will be 39 hours with regular overtime available. Overtime at time and a half and double time for Saturday Pm and Sundays.
